Class EmfPlusCustomLineCapArrowData
名称: Aspose.Imaging.FileFormats.Emf.EmfPlus.Objects 收藏: Aspose.Imaging.dll (25.4.0)
EmfPlusCustomLineCapArrowData 对象指定可调整的箭头数据,以便为定制的线条覆盖。
public sealed class EmfPlusCustomLineCapArrowData : EmfPlusCustomBaseLineCap
Inheritance
object ← MetaObject ← EmfPlusObject ← EmfPlusStructureObjectType ← EmfPlusCustomBaseLineCap ← EmfPlusCustomLineCapArrowData
继承人
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
EmfPlusCustomLineCapArrowData()
public EmfPlusCustomLineCapArrowData()
Properties
FillHotSpot
获取或设置目前未使用的 EmfPlusPointF 对象. 必须设置为 {0.0, 0.0}。
public PointF FillHotSpot { get; set; }
财产价值
FillState
收到或设置一个 32 位 Boolean 值,说明箭头是否被填满。没有填写,只有输出被提取
public bool FillState { get; set; }
财产价值
Height
收到或设置一个 32 位浮动点值,指定箭头顶的高度。
public float Height { get; set; }
财产价值
LineEndCap
接收或设置一个 32 位未签名整合器,指定 LineCap 列表中的值,指示线条字符使用在线的结尾被拖动
public EmfPlusLineCapType LineEndCap { get; set; }
财产价值
LineHotSpot
收到或设置目前未使用的 EmfPlusPointF 对象. 必须设置为 {0.0, 0.0}。
public PointF LineHotSpot { get; set; }
财产价值
LineJoin
获取或设置 32 位未签名整合器,在 LineJoin 中指定值列表,说明如何连接两条线,由相同的铅笔和其结尾相遇,在两条线的交叉结尾,一条线连接使连接看起来更连续。
public EmfPlusLineJoinType LineJoin { get; set; }
财产价值
LineMiterLimit
收到或设置一个 32 位浮动点值,该值指定了的厚度在一个测量的角,通过设置最大允许的尺寸长度与线宽度的比例
public float LineMiterLimit { get; set; }
财产价值
LineStartCap
接收或设置一个 32 位未签名整合器,指定 LineCap 列表中的值,指示线条字符使用在线路的开始时进行拖拉
public EmfPlusLineCapType LineStartCap { get; set; }
财产价值
MiddleInset
接收或设置一个 32 位浮动点值,指定在箭头输出线之间的像素数量帽子和箭头帽子的填充。
public float MiddleInset { get; set; }
财产价值
Width
收到或设置一个 32 位浮动点值,指定箭头盖的宽度
public float Width { get; set; }
财产价值
WidthScale
收到或设置一个 32 位浮动点值,该值指定了可扩展一个 EmfPlusCustomLineCap 对象的宽度图形铅笔用于绘制线条
public float WidthScale { get; set; }